MµMetal / MuMetal / µMetal / HyMu80 /镍铁钼/坡莫合金80 / Super Muniperm / FeNi80Mo5 / Super MuMetal / SofMag80 / 超级合金/ Aperam /蠕变/坡莫合金C / EFI合金79 / Magnifer 7904 / Hipernom /钼坡莫合金/ Amumetal 国际标准:ASTM A 753,DIN 17405,IEC 404,JIS C 2531 化学成分: 镍80%,钼5%,铁平衡,一些杂质 物理性质 公制 英语 密度 8.74克/立方厘米 0.316磅/英寸³ 机械性能 公制 英语 硬度,布氏 105-290 105-290 断裂拉伸强度 530-900兆帕 76900-131000磅/平方英寸 拉伸模量 190-221 GPa 27600-32100 ksi 悬臂梁式冲击,无缺口 0.420-1.00焦耳/厘米 0.787-1.87英尺磅/英寸 电学特性 公制 英语 电阻率 0.0000550-0.0000620欧姆-厘米 0.0000550-0.0000620欧姆-厘米 磁导率 最低60000 最低60000 最大240000 最大240000 磁力矫顽力,H c 0.0126大江 0.0126大江 剩磁,B r 3700高斯 3700高斯 居里温度 380°摄氏度 716°F 热性能 公制 英语 线性CTE 13.0 µm / m-°C 7.22微英寸/英寸°F 温度20.0-100°C 温度68.0-212°F 导热系数 30.0-35.0 W / mK 208-243 BTU-in /hr-ft²-°F 组件元素属性 公制 英语 铁,铁 14% 14% 钼钼 4-6% 4-6% 镍镍 79-81% 79-81% 描述性 饱和感应(T) 0.77 Mu-metal是一种具有很高磁导率的镍铁软磁合金,用于保护敏感的电子设备免受静电或低频磁场的影响。 钼金属的相对磁导率值通常为80,000–100,000,而普通钢则为数千。它是一种“软”磁性材料。它具有较低的磁各向异性和磁致伸缩性,因此具有较低的矫顽力,因此在低磁场下会饱和。当在交流磁路中使用时,它具有较低的磁滞损耗。 mu-metal具有更大的优势,因为它更具延展性和可加工性,可以轻松地制成磁屏蔽所需的薄板。 Mu金属物体最终成型后需要进行热处理-在氢气氛中的磁场中退火,这将磁导率提高了约40倍。退火改变了材料的晶体结构,排列了晶粒并去除了一些杂质,特别是碳,这些杂质阻碍了磁畴边界的自由运动。退火后的弯曲或机械冲击可能会破坏材料的晶粒排列,从而导致受影响区域的磁导率下降,可以通过重复进行氢退火步骤来恢复该渗透率。 磁屏蔽 mu-metal的高磁导率为磁通量提供了低磁阻路径,从而使其用于抗静电或缓慢变化的磁场的磁屏蔽中。用诸如mu-metal之类的高磁导率合金制成的磁屏蔽的作用不是通过阻止磁场,而是通过为屏蔽区域周围的磁力线提供路径。因此,屏蔽的最佳形状是围绕屏蔽空间的密闭容器。微米级金属屏蔽的有效性随合金的渗透性而降低,在低磁场强度和高饱和强度下由于饱和而降低。因此,μ-金属屏蔽通常由几个外壳构成,一个外壳在另一个外壳之间,每个外壳依次减小其内部的磁场。由于mu金属在如此低的磁场下会饱和,因此有时多层屏蔽中的外层是由普通钢制成的。其较高的饱和度值使其能够处理更强的磁场,将其降低到可以被内部mu-metal层有效屏蔽的较低水平。 MuMetal的流行屏蔽应用 · 屏蔽射频磁场 · 低温护盾 · 屏蔽天然地球磁铁 · 示波器中使用的阴极射线管(CRT) · 对磁场敏感的电子设备 · 交流磁路 · 屏蔽电场 · 移动网络和天线射线 · SQUID的屏蔽–超导量子干涉仪- · 电报电缆 · 电力变压器,以mu-金属外壳制成,以防止它们影响附近的电路。高质量但低噪声的音频变压器。 · 硬盘,在驱动器中的磁铁上具有mu-metal背衬,以使磁场远离磁盘 · 模拟示波器中使用的阴极射线管,具有多金属屏蔽,可防止杂散磁场使电子束偏转 · 磁性留声机唱头,具有多金属外壳,可减少播放LP时的干扰 · 磁共振成像设备 · 脑磁图和心磁图中使用的磁力计 · 光电倍增管 · 真空室,用于低能电子的实验,例如光电子能谱。 · 超导电路,尤其是约瑟夫森结电路 · 磁通门磁力计和指南针作为传感器的一部分 · 接地故障中断器芯 · 防盗窃设备 · 录音机磁头叠片 · 磁力计线轴 常见问题解答(FAQ) 什么是磁场? 从地球磁场到人造源(如磁铁,电动机和变压器)的磁场(交流和直流)都将我们包围着。当一块敏感设备受到这些场的影响时,我们需要制作一个屏蔽罩。受影响的示例是阴极射线管,光电倍增管,音频变压器,扫描电子显微镜,位置传感器。 磁屏蔽如何工作? 没有已知的材料可以阻挡磁场而不会自身被磁力吸引。磁屏蔽层就像海绵一样,可以重定向屏蔽层周围的磁场,而不是通过被屏蔽的敏感仪器。为了成为良好的磁屏蔽材料,它必须具有高磁导率,这意味着磁场线会强烈吸引到屏蔽材料上。 根据磁场强度选择最常用的屏蔽合金。如果磁场对于所选材料而言过高,它将饱和并失效。在这种情况下,您可以将多层屏蔽层与不同合金组合使用。合金还应具有非常低的剩磁,以防止其永久磁化。 屏蔽的最佳形状是什么? 最有效的形状是球形,但这很难制造,并且在大多数屏蔽应用中不切实际。次佳的是封闭端的气缸。这些端盖显着增加了屏蔽衰减。其次是箱形,但拐角必须具有较大的弯曲半径,以最大程度地减少磁通泄漏。如果可能,请勿使用平板纸。 射频和电磁屏蔽之间有什么区别? 为了阻止高频场(> 100 kHz),需要使用射频屏蔽,并且通常使用铜,铝,金属化塑料,因为它们具有导电性并且几乎没有磁导率。电磁屏蔽通常在30 – 300 Hz交流范围内。 直流电和交流电有什么区别? DC是仅在一个方向上流动的直流电,例如从地球发出或由磁铁和某些电动机产生的磁场。 AC是交流电,可在短时间内反转其方向,这些磁场是由典型的50-60 Hz电力设备产生的。 磁屏蔽对这两种类型均有效。 什么是导磁率? 它是一种吸收磁通量的材料。它是磁通密度与场强的比率。磁导率越高,磁屏蔽衰减性能越好。 什么是场衰减? 这也称为屏蔽系数(S),是磁屏蔽层外部的磁场强度(Ha)与屏蔽层内部的合成磁场之比,即Ha / Hi(无单位)或S = 20 x log(Ha / Hi)(Db)。根据材料的渗透性,屏蔽的形状和尺寸以及材料的厚度,可以使用各种公式。 在大多数情况下,这些公式仅是近似值,并且仅适用于DC字段。 对于封闭的屏蔽罐: S = 4/3 X(Mu xd / D) 哪里: 渗透率(相对) d : 材料厚度 D: 屏蔽直径 对于在磁场横向磁场中的长空心圆柱体: S = Mu xd / D 对于立方屏蔽箱:S = 4/5 X(Mu xd / a) a:盒边长度。 在多层屏蔽的情况下,由绝缘垫片提供气隙 各个屏蔽的屏蔽系数相乘 共同导致极好的屏蔽系数。 对于双层屏蔽:S = S1 x((S2 x(2 x直径变化 /直径)) FeNi48和MuMetal为什么同时使用? FeNi48的磁导率很高,但饱和度较低,而FeNi48的磁导率较低,但饱和度较高。 FeNi48用于最接近强磁场的区域,以保护Mumetal认为材料不饱和。 为什么Mµ-Metal,FeNi48和纯铁需要进行最终热处理? 塑性变形后高温 需要热处理以重新排列晶体结构以及允许晶粒生长。没有这种最终的热处理,磁性能和屏蔽衰减将大大降低。 低温是否会影响MuMetal的性能? MuMetal受低温影响。饱和感应保持不变,但磁导率降低。在低温下,我们需要使用特殊的低温MuMetall,我们也提供该产品。 可以在高真空下使用磁屏蔽材料吗? Slide gate plate brick is becoming more and more important in modern iron and steel smelting process, and becoming an indispensable part of smelting.
It is a molten steel control device of continuous casting machine in the process of casting.It could precisely adjust the molten steel flow rate that from ladle to continuous casting tundish to balance the inflows and outflows of molten steel, which makes it easier to control the continuous casting operation.Now, slide nozzle system is widely used in ladle and tundish ladle in worldwide.
1. Slide gate plate and nozzle systemModel: 1QC 2QC, 1BK,2BK, C51. LQ60/80/, LS50/70/90, LQLG20 21 22(VSV374 421 441)FLOCON 4200/6300/ B50/250, LQLV50/150/180 ....Small Size Slide plate-----Al-C; Middle & Large size slide plate-------AL-Zr-C; Al-C; or Both.Special Steel (Ca-treatment steel)------Al-Spinel ; Mg Spinel . Ladle nozzle: Al-C; Al-Zr-C; Al-Spinel....2. Service Result for slide gate plate and nozzle system:Service life depends on many points:1)Different Raw Material,2)Production Process(Firing temperature, oil immersion, drying temperature...)3)Steel type4)Steel making condition5)Different operation modeAnd so on.... 3. Type of production design1) High Temperature Burnt Slide Gate Plate and ladle nozzle system High performance ladle slide gate plate refractories adopts tabular alumina, carbonaceous material and zirconia-containing material as main raw materials, adds in high performance antioxidants, uses phenolic resin as binder, formed under high-pressure and burned under high temperature. Mainly used in large and medium-sized ladles.2) Low Temperature Burnt Slide Gate Plate and nozzle systemTabular alumina, zirconia-containing material and spinel as major raw materials, adding in special metal, using phenolic resin as binder, being burned under low temperature to produce the products, Mainly used in small and medium-sized ladle.3) Un-burned Slide Gate Plate and nozzle systemWithout the process of burned, tar impregnated and distilled, simple processing. Mainly used in small and medium-sized ladle.4.Feature of our slide plate, nozzle and well block:1.Excellent thermal stability2.High temperature strength3.Resistance to molten metal and slag4.Consistency in shape and size5.Ability to sustain mechanical treatment without detriment to the surface integrity

he low clearance type hoist achieves an increase in the effective lifting stroke by positioning the hoist main unit on the side of the operating track, thereby reducing the distance from the bottom of the track to the upper limit position of the hook.
Using ring-shaped chains as the load-bearing and transmission components, it features a small size, light weight, and compact structure. It is often used in places with limited space and strict requirements for clear height, such as low-rise factories and temporary working areas.
